[ 
https://issues.apache.org/jira/browse/YETUS-321?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15177292#comment-15177292
 ] 

Andrew Wang commented on YETUS-321:
-----------------------------------

bq. For end users, it's a huge flag that while there isn't a release note, they 
may want to go look at the JIRA to see what is actually happening. It's also 
extremely useful for REs as a reminder that they really should go fix that 
before release when they do that visual inspection of the notes.

I'd like to get to a paradigm where lint is treated like a compile error, so 
broken release docs never get released. This initial step of being able to 
selectively disable filters is a partial solution; if we had per-JIRA "ignore" 
options, I think that's complete. We can also turn on lint printing by default 
so it always shows up for RMs, and if the "--lint" flag is specified, also set 
a non-zero status code and wipe the directories on error.

Happy to do the above work if this sounds good.

> Add flag to releasedocmaker.py to ignore missing component in lint mode
> -----------------------------------------------------------------------
>
>                 Key: YETUS-321
>                 URL: https://issues.apache.org/jira/browse/YETUS-321
>             Project: Yetus
>          Issue Type: Improvement
>    Affects Versions: 0.1.0
>            Reporter: Andrew Wang
>            Assignee: Andrew Wang
>         Attachments: yetus-321.001.patch, yetus-321.002.patch
>
>
> Not all projects require the "component" field in JIRA. For these projects, 
> it would be nice to ignore the "missing component" errors in lint mode.



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

Reply via email to